A Comparison Of 9 Best HTML5 Video Players For Online Video Streaming In 2026
HTML5 video players significantly play an important role in the world of streaming architecture and contribute their share towards the enrichment of content distribution across platforms or devices.
Initially introduced to the market in 2014, HTML5 video players quickly gained widespread adoption due to their superior technologies compared to other options available in the market.
These online video players are highly compatible and flexible, easily assisting broadcasters, publishers, or content distributors in reaching a larger set of demographics with their compiled streams.
However, if you require more control over your video assets in terms of how they are displayed and how users interact with your content, then you might need a privately-owned custom video player.
Today, HTML5 video players aren’t limited to web usage; they tend to deliver high-quality broadcasts across major device platforms such as mobile, tablet, smart TV, etc.
With the rapid growth of the live streaming & OTT industry, a number of publishers and over-the-top service providers rely on advanced player technology, including the best hls video players, to distribute their content across regions and engage and connect with their viewers quickly.
But before we delve into the details, let’s take a closer look at what an HTML5 video player does.
Best HTML5 Video Players:
HTML5 video players have become essential for web developers and content creators looking to deliver high-quality video content to users across various devices.
These video players are designed to support the HTML5 video element, offering compatibility, customization options, and features like adaptive streaming, cross-browser support, and more.
Here are some of the Best HLS Video Players available in the market:
- VPlayed
- THEOPlayer
- Kaltura
- JW Player
- Flow Player
- Brid TV
- VideoJS
- Muvi
- Dacast
These represent a selection of the best HTML5 video players, each with its own set of features and capabilities.
Let’s begin with a detailed overview of HTML5 players and their benefits, followed by an in-depth examination of each of the top HTML5 video players mentioned above.
Table of Contents
What Is An HTML5 Video Player?
An HTML5 video player is a technology that allows you to play videos on websites without additional plugins or software. It enables viewers to watch videos directly on a website without opening a separate media player.

Built using HTML5, a programming language used to create and structure web content. HTML5 video player is essential for embedding videos directly into web pages. Most modern-day web browsers like Chrome, Safari, and Firefox fully support HTML5 video playback.
With an HTML5 video player, you gain control over video playback, volume adjustment, and the ability to add features like captions or subtitles. This technology provides a convenient way for content creators to present and share their videos online across various platforms and devices.
Top Benefits Of Streaming With An HTML5 Video Player
Discover the myriad advantages of utilizing HTML5 video players for seamless video streaming.
Enjoy heightened compatibility across devices, enhanced performance, and an overall improved user experience.
Explore how the cutting-edge technology of HTML5 video players can boost your content delivery, ensuring top-notch quality for your end audience.
1. All Device Compatibility
Most of the sophisticated browsers are supported by HTML5 video player that stream videos and are compatible with any device such as mobile screens, TV, etc.
This video player’s compatibility alone makes it very valuable.
2. Fully-customizable Player
Nearly everything is configurable when using renowned over-the-top providers to cater to custom needs.
Receive immediate assistance from a group of platform developers who have pre-installed features and themes for your proprietary media players that can be customised.
3. Affordability
It should go without saying that open-source HTML5 video players are more expensive.
However, examining their free-to-use source code has a significant advantage that cannot be overlooked. Using an OTT solution with many integrations can be a long-term consideration.

4. Resource Efficient
One of the best benefits of a HTML5 video player is its requirement is with minimum resources.
Unlike flash player, HTML5 does not require any additional plug-ins and thus it is simpler in terms of its functionalities which requires light-weight essentials.
5. Easy Integrations
They enable developers or anyone who requires to share videos on any platform to easily integrate it.
Mostly, the video monetization platforms require the need to share content on different websites & a media player online lets you easily integrate videos with built-in video tags.
Looking To Build Your Own VOD Platform?
Start and Grow Your Video Streaming Service With 1000+ Features & 9+ Revenue Models.
Highly Customizable
Life Time Ownership
Own 100% of Your Revenue
Full-Branding Freedom

How To Choose the Best HTML5 Video Player For Your Streaming Platform?
While there may not be a standard procedure for selecting a custom HTML5 video player, understanding the fundamental considerations is of utmost importance.
In fact, most online video streaming platforms or video streaming servers come equipped with built-in players. However, to ensure optimal performance, look for the following aspects when choosing the right one for your business needs.
- Multiple Video Source Specifications
Browsers must be able to play your video source files in order to share your videos across various websites and video streaming platforms.
However, it’s unlikely that every browser will accept the same video codec or source file, so the HTML5 video player needs to handle a variety of video source requirements for seamless browser compatibility.
- Flexible Video Control
This guarantees that you can quickly display or conceal different video controls on different browsers which includes volume, download, play, pause, full screen mode, and others.
For certain browsers, you can opt to conceal or disable features like “download” and “full screen,” amongst others.
- Tailor-made Accessories of Videos
By adjusting various video aspects, such as resizing a video and maintaining the aspect ratio and video size, makes content compatible with a variety of platforms.
Viewers will therefore be able to access high-quality videos on any platform.
- Added Functionalities
A solid HTML5 player not only fulfils the very minimum requirements but also offers additional features to provide your audience with a top-notch streaming experience.
Captions and subtitles, regulating playback speed, specifying playback start and end timestamps, autoplay, mute, loop, etc. are a few of the essential solutions.
What Are The Features Of An HTML5 Video Player?
An HTML5 video player boasts a number of features that render it indispensable for modern web experiences.
Primarily, it demands fewer resources, ensuring smooth playback without overburdening the system. Its seamless integration into websites and apps simplifies the overall user experience.
Furthermore, HTML5 brings advanced benefits and customization options, empowering developers to craft engaging media experiences.
With native video support across major browsers, HTML5 ensures cross-device compatibility and even provides offline storage capabilities.
The 7+ Best HTML5 Video Players For Streaming in 2026
When it comes to online video streaming, there are many HTML5 video players available.
However, some are considered to be the best HTML5 Players in the market because of their entensive feature list and offerings. VPlayed, THEOPlayer, Kaltura, JWPlayer, Flow Player, Brid.TV, and VideoJS are among the top HTML5 video players to be considered in 2026.
With that being said, let’s get right in and know more about each of them in the upcoming sections.
1. VPlayed
Robust Over-the-top streaming solution with 100% customization

VPlayed is a one-stop streaming solution that provides unparalleled viewing experience using customized HTML5 video player.
Ensure your viewers get a fastest video playback along with supported technologies like adaptive bitrate streaming across all devices.
Acquire the freedom to customize your streaming platform completely at VPlayed along with 150+ streaming features.
Some Of VPlayed’s HTML5 Video Players Highlighted Features Are:
- Now you can stream videos in 4K added with multi-lingual support
- Enjoy buffer-free content as network bandwidth is no more a worry
- Store & broadcast videos in MPEG DASH, MP4 formats for flexibility
- Videos can be delivered with future-oriented tech-stack like HLS
- Fastest playback with simultaneous ad runs in seekbar thumbnails
Pros & Cons
- Ensures platform protection with domain validation
- Offers subtitle settings for varied purpose
- Doesn’t provide free trials before opting solutions
2. THEOPlayer
Premium video broadcasting solution used by dozen of brands

THEOplayer is well-known HTML5 video player used by dozens of brands and online video providers globally.
This player is one of the first ones to be introduced in the market with supports customization of video players to stream on smart TV apps.
They are mostly used for OTT streaming and by payTV service providers. THEOPlayer supports other viewing formats like HLS, MPEG-DASH, which ensures smooth playability.
Some Of Its Best Video Player’s Highlighted Features Are:
- Offers dozens of integrations across wide combinations of video ecosystem
- Extensive SDK support with detailed documentation making it go-to solution
- Enterprise video player is for media giants, large businesses worldwide
- THEOPlayer is the first to introduce Apple’s low-latency HLS streaming
- Provides high-end customizability & reliant video delivery solution
Pros & Cons
- Offers various testing tools
- Provides Player API & SDK
- Pricing factors aren’t favourable
3. Kaltura
Unified video platform for online streaming business with html5 player

Kaltura is a renowned multi-platform which provides HLS streaming solution & specializes in live streaming and e-learning.
Kaltura’s video player for website comes with reliant fast cloud hosting solution, so publishers who tend to choose this platform suffices their need.
The solution is backedup with plenty of third-paty plugins added with an dynamic API, allowing easy integrations with other services.
Highlighted Features Of Kaltura’s Custom Video Player Are:
- A ready-made elearning platform with virtual classroom
- Best choice with its HTML5 video players engagement
- Multiplatfom support with unified development API
- Resource loader supports powerful player metadata
- Flexible player platform integrates with major ad networks
Pros & Cons
- Supports varied third-party integrations
- Inclusive of cloud video hosting
- Lacks revenue-generating options
4. JWPlayer
Video streaming platform with reliant Html5 video player for streaming

The initial source code for the first YouTube video player included JW Player.
But over time, the player evolved to include HTML5 streaming, and today it is regarded as one of the most reliable video players available.
JW Player, which has been available for more than 15 years, is one of the major players in the video industry.
Nowadays, it provides thousands of publishers worldwide with buffer-free HLS and MPEG-DASH streaming.
Some Of Its Highlighted Features Of Online Video Players Are:
- Versatile perks include extensive 360° video, VR support
- Offers video CMS alongside its player for video hosting
- Capacitates with handy audience engagement systems
- Extensive cross-platform opportunities in Android & iOS SDKs
- Delivers player bidding with content matching systems
Pros & Cons
- Most well-established HTML5 players in the industry
- Provides AVOD & SVOD monetization models
- Direct support is only available to premium users
Tired of using JW Player?
5. Flow Player
Performance-first html5 video player for exclusive streams

Another strong video player and online video platform counts the Flowplayer.
It is performance-driven and furnishes with various streaming solutions with video file formats like HLS, MP4, MPEG-DASH, etc.
The robust html5 video player offers a variety of expert streaming options with hosting & encoding capabilities. Professional streaming works well with Flowplayer because of its speed and small size.
Highlighted Features Of HTML5 Player Video Are:
- Highly customizable with third-party integrations
- Provides built-in ad based monetization options
- Enables broadcasters to stream with API access
- Easy to use with high engagement rates concurrently
- Ad-scheduling feasibility added with refined analytics
Pros & Cons
- Low latency streaming
- Live streaming opportunities
- There’s no availability of free plans
6. Brid TV
Stream lag-free with compatible html5 video player

Brid TV is a premium online video platform that provides advanced HTML5 player with ad-based monetization solutions for mid to large-scale organizations.
Brid TV’s lightweight video player offers adaptive HLS streaming service for live & video on demand platform.
The HTML5 video player from Brid.TV features a full-featured video CMS as well as real-time video analytics that are accessible to all users.
Highlighted Features Of HTML5 Media Player Includes:
- Enterprise video hosting is Brid.TV’s significant feature
- Supports latest VAST & VPAID ad tags in setup process
- In-header bidding technology for maximizing ad revenue
- Get the facility to whitelabel vod platform with customized solution
- Provides full API & mobile SDK support for any media streaming
Pros & Cons
- Audio streaming with 360 video support
- OTT and CTV compatibility
- No subscription-based monetization
7. VideoJS
Highly customizable online video player with plugin support

Video JS is a free and open-source online html5 video player that provides features with basic playback options such as autoplay or pre-load.
Video JS team uses JavaScript for plugging cross-browser irregularities, to ensure that your content appears in the best possible way.
They also help in adding support for HTML5 tags for other technical essentialities to introduce features such as subtitles & full-screen displays.
Highlighted Features Of HTML5 Player Include
- Video playback with VideoJS can be enjoyed on mobile & desktop devices
- Facilitates advanced plugins that support social media platforms easily
- Track video analytics right from the player & is one of standout features
- Branding can be added in player controls with include chromecast support
- It is an open source media player compatible with multiple 3rd-party plugins
Pros & Cons
- Brilliant customization potential
- Backend contains optional support for Flash browsers
- Need to have basic idea about scripting so implementation becomes difficult
8. Muvi

Muvi is a white-label platform for creating a customized HTML5 video streaming service. It offers powerful features similar to VPlayed, albeit it operates on a SaaS-based model.
What makes Muvi stand out as the best HTML5 video player platform?
Firstly, it allows extensive customization options to resonate with the brand image and target audience.
Secondly, Muvi provides vibrant revenue models. This includes subscriptions, pay-per-view, ads, coupons, promotions, etc.
Moreover, Muvi seamlessly integrates with popular systems, simplifying workflow connections.
With its user-friendly interface and powerful tools, Muvi is the top choice for businesses looking for a reliable HTML5 video player platform.
Features of Muvi’s HTML5 Video Player include:
- Customize your video player’s appearance with Muvi’s HTML5 player.
- Enjoy exceptional video streaming quality with 4K resolution HDR support.
- Create a stunning website with pre-built designs optimized for HTML5 playback.
- Monetize your videos quickly with skippable and non-skippable ads (supports both CSAI and SSAI)
- Upload and share music files effortlessly with Muvi’s audio file feature.
- Engage and reward loyal viewers with Muvi’s loyalty program.
- Simplify video streaming with Muvi’s user-friendly HTML5 player.
9. Dacast

Dacast’s HTML5 video player is an excellent tool that makes watching videos online a seamless experience. It’s designed to work smoothly on any device using a computer, tablet, or smartphone.
Dacast’s player is versatile and supports a wide range of video formats.
You can upload and play videos in different file types without any hassle. This means you can share your videos with others easily, regardless of their device.
Another great feature of Dacast’s HTML5 player is its playback quality. It ensures your videos are highly defined, providing viewers with crisp and clear visuals.
Additionally, Dacast’s HTML5 player offers smooth and buffer-free playback. It utilizes advanced HLS streaming technology to optimize video delivery.
What does it mean?
Viewers can enjoy uninterrupted playback without annoying pauses or loading times.
Furthermore, the player deploys powerful features like video analytics and real-time performance tracking.
So, you can track important metrics such as viewer engagement and playback duration. And this information can help you gain insights into your audience’s preferences and improve your video content accordingly.
Dacast’s HTML5 Video Player Features:
- Customize and brand your HTML5 video player to match your business
- Use HLS support for seamless streaming across devices
- Increase views by embedding the HTML5 player on your website, mobile apps, and Smart TVs
- Use chapter markers to indicate different sections in your videos
- Monetize your content with secure paywall features for both live and on-demand videos
- Host audio content like music and podcasts alongside videos on your HTML5 player
- Control access to your content based on regions or domains
- Add captions and subtitles to your videos for improved accessibility
- Get 24/7 customer support to optimize your streaming experience
Conclusion:
In the current outlook, HTML5 players stand out as one of the greatest boons for businesses aiming to enhance online video distribution.
Offering extensive customization, engagement analysis, and monetization possibilities, these video players ensure dependable and seamless video transmission.
Nevertheless, selecting the right one becomes more challenging due to variations in features, capabilities, accessibility, and other aspects.
While it may seem inconspicuous, understanding that the HTML5 video player is a crucial component of your video hosting solution that significantly influences streaming quality, speed, compatibility, sharing, adaptability, and various other aspects.
When choosing a solution, it is quintessential to closely examine all of its characteristics and specifics.
While the aforementioned comparative study may aid in decision-making, it is crucial to remember that your company has specific objectives to meet. Therefore, a hosting platform with a reliable HTML5 player must consider these objectives pivotally.
If You Already Have An Idea To Start A Video Streaming Business With HTML5 Player, Schedule A Free Demo And We’ll Get You On The Road To Video Streaming Success
Frequently Asked Questions(FAQ):
1. What is an HTML5 video player?
An HTML5 video player is a browser-based media player that allows users to play video content without the need for third-party plugins like Flash or Silverlight. Video player uses the HTML5 video tag to display video content and can be customized with CSS and JavaScript.
2. How to choose the best HTML5 video player?
With so many choices of open-sourced and commercial HTML5 video players, it could be difficult to choose the one that suits your business needs. Keep in mind that each one offers a variety of features at different price ranges.
Here are some of the features that you can check before the selection process.
1. Affordability.
2. Device compatibility.
3. Software updates.
4. Features and add-ons.
3. How to ensure that HTML5 Video player is secure?
It is worth mentioning that HTML5 video players offer better protection than any other online media players that use Flash code, even though no web video player can be said to be totally immune to cybersecurity risks. Still, the majority of HTML5 players provide viewers with secure streaming. The good news is that open-sourced players are just as secure as those offered for commercial use.
4. What are the key features of an online video player?
A feature-rich online video player can improve the overall user experience and take up the revenue to a whole different level. Here is a list of the top 5 features that are a must-have for any online video player to facilitate video streaming.
1. Simple to navigate.
2. Fully HTML5 video player.
3. Content security.
4. Multiple Ad serving models.
5. Low latency.
5. What types of video formats does the HTML5 player support?
There are three video formats that work properly in modern browsers. Unfortunately, none of these work in all browsers, so a combination of at least two are required for meaningful HTML5 video support. HTML5 players have three playback options: MP4, WebM, and Ogg. Note that only 58% of browsers support WebM, and Safari doesn’t support Ogg. Aside from that, MP4 is disabled by default in Firefox 24.
6. Which HTML5 player is best for video streaming?
The default HTML5 video player may appear to be a straightforward option, but it only provides basic capabilities such as play/pause and the ability to define the dimensions of your video. However, you can take it a step further by using a customizable HTML5 video player solution, which will provide you with extra video player options such as branding, closed captioning, and adaptive bitrate streaming.
7. What are the benefits of using html5 video player?
HTML5 video players are gaining popularity due to their unique features and solutions. Here are the top 5 benefits of using an HTML5 video player.
1. Fewer resources are required.
2. Simple to integrate and manage.
3. Provides full browser support.
4. Styled to your preferences in minutes.
5. Simple to add applications, tools, and links.
8. What are some best html5 video player for streaming?
Here are some of the top HTML5 video players available in the market:
VPlayed
THEOPlayer
Kaltura
JW Player
Flow Player
Brid.TV
VideoJS
Muvi
Dacast
